Oat Bran Oatmeal Muffins - Vegan Sugar-Free
Difficulty - easy ~ Makes about 15 muffins
This great recipe is new to my collection I don't know where I clipped
it from. I wasn't totally keen on the texture of the muffins so add
oatmeal and more cinnamon. They are NOT very sweet so if you like things
a bit sweeter I would recommend you add 1/4-1/2 cup of sugar. My husband
thought they were sweet enough but I wanted them a bit sweeter!!! I'll
let you know where else you can play with the recipe more to fine tune
it to your liking.
3 large apples peeled and chopped (about 3 cups..if you like less apples
just use 2)
1 cup whole wheat pastry flour
1 cup oatmeal flaked (try not to use instant, its just more processed
and less nutritious)
1 cup unbleached white flour
1 cup oat bran
(NB: total amount of dry is 4 cups. Play around if you like don't like
oatmeal or oat bran ..add more flour, wheat germ, spelt flour)
2 1/2 tsp baking soda
2 tsp cinnamon or less
1/2 tsp nutmeg
1 12oz of apple juice concentrate thawed
3 tbsp applesauce (if you don't have you can skip this)
1 cup water ..less depending on batter, could also add apple juice
1/2 tsp salt
2 tsp cider vinegar
1. Heat oven 325 F. Lightly oil muffin tin.
2. Pour a bit of the apple juice concentrate onto the oatmeal and let
sit for a few minutes to soften.
3. Mix the rest of the dry ingredients together. Then add softened oatmeal
to the dry ingredients. (if you are adding sugar, do it here. If you
want to stick to a vegan recipe add any organic sugar you like)
4. Add apples to the dry mixture to coat (keeps them from sinking).
Mix it well because once you add the liquid you don't want to stir it
a lot otherwise you will have a less tender muffin. Then add the apple
juice concentrate mixed with the vinegar. If its still dry, add the
applesauce or add some water until batter forms. Fill muffin tins
5. Bake for 25-30 minutes.
